I lead the trustee governance team responsible for leading our thinking on governance issues and trustee support and training, as well as being responsible for clients. I have helped various clients to improve their governance arrangements and effective management of their pension schemes.

I have a particular interest in defined contribution pension schemes and their development. Many clients look after both defined benefit and defined contribution pension schemes and often the time available for defined contribution issues can get squeezed.

How do you get under the skin of a client's business?

A few years ago, after working closely with trustees for many years, I became a trustee of the Mineworkers' Pension Scheme. The scheme is fantastically well supported and aspires to be at the forefront of the highest standards of trustee governance. I now have even more sympathy with our trustee clients' difficult balancing act of having legal responsibility but little, day-to-day involvement in the running of the scheme.

What's your single greatest contribution to Wragge & Co's corporate responsibility?

I have been a voluntary adviser for the Pensions Advisory Service (TPAS) for many years. I wanted to do some voluntary work and, while it's not as glamorous and exciting as trekking in the Himalayas or some other Wragge and Co initiatives, it's an area where my experience gives me special skills. It is a great feeling when you can help a member finally to understand his pension entitlement or to convince a pension scheme to take a member's claim seriously. TPAS helps members of the public who could never afford professional fees.

I also was a member of the TPAS Board for six years and on a sub-committee which was charged with updating its governance structures in line with the combined code and the Nolan principles.

Regulator and clearance: new draft guidance

The Pensions Regulator introduced the clearance procedure in April 2005. It allows the regulator to confirm whether or not a particular event, action or situation will lead it to use its anti-avoidance powers.

Pensions Act 2004: could you be a cross-border scheme?

New cross-border requirements came into force on 30 December 2005. Broadly speaking, trustees must not accept contributions from an employer in relation to active members (other than certain seconded employees) who work in another EU member state.
